Celtic Football Club is reportedly keeping an eye on Scott McKenna, a decorated 29-year-old centre-back currently playing for Dinamo Zagreb in Croatia. The club has sent scouts to monitor his performance, but they face competition from other clubs interested in the Scotland international. Dinamo Zagreb's chief scout, Tomislav Sokota, confirmed that serious offers are being made, with a valuation of £10 million for McKenna. After progressing through the ranks at Aberdeen, McKenna has had a mixed career, including a stint at Nottingham Forest and a recent move to Zagreb on a Bosman transfer. He has been instrumental in Dinamo's success, contributing to their dominance in domestic competitions with 37 appearances this season. However, as Celtic plans a squad overhaul, they may reconsider pursuing McKenna due to his age and the need for a right-footed defender to complement their current lineup.
